Which statement completes Toilet Secure Checks?

Explanation:
Toilet Secure Checks focus on making sure lavatories are not accessible and are in a safe, secure state during critical phases of flight. The essential action is to close and lock the toilet doors so passengers cannot open them and crew can move about the cabin safely, with privacy maintained for those using the lavatories when they are allowed to be used. This directly achieves security and safety objectives of the check. Doors left open would defeat the purpose of securing the lavatory and privacy; placing luggage in toilets is hazardous and not allowed; keeping the lights on does not address the core need to physically secure access to the lavatory.
